The lighting of the Olympic torch in Atlanta, GA, by legendary boxer Muhammad Ali stood out as the most memorable moment at the opening ceremonies of the 1996 Olympic Games. The former heavyweight champion was a surprise choice to perform the ceremonial duties at the Olympic stadium.
Suddenly, wonderfully, Muhammed Ali rose into sight above the rim of the stadium, an appearance so surprising it took your breath away.
After a month of secrecy, clandestine travel and midnight rehearsal, the great man would light the flame opening the Olympic Games in Atlanta.
Swimmer Janet Evans carried the flame up a long ramp to the stadium rim, there touching her torch to Ali's, and then the 1960 Olympic gold medalist raised high the flame in his right hand.
